Epoxy: Building a steam box

I've just built an 8' steam box to help my daughter's classroom build a toboggan. It is 1/2" plywood with 2" EPS form for insulation and then another 1/2" plywood layer. Can I use my leftover epoxy to seal it up so it doesn't absorb water and weigh a ton, or will the epoxy go soft when the heat inside the box gets to 212 F? Should I glass the inside. I have extra glass pieces from the many boats I've built. Thanks. BTW- I have a leftover Raka 127 resin and 350 harderner.
